What build are you running?
Is your class tree complimentary to your build? I.e. weapon damage nodes for weapon damage
Is your gear rolled for the build you have? Firepower for weapons, anomaly for skills.
Are you using mods that synergise with your build?
I definitely suggest you read through the guides and builds. There are a plethora of suggestions and guides. Upgrading is very important and as well as the mods you use.
